Fit Tip: Smelling ammonia after/during your workout? Feedback from your body: you don’t have enough carbohydrates in the bank to fuel your workout. The smell is the result of muscle cannibalization: you breathe out the fumes (other people can’t smell it usually: no worries).
If it happens every now and then, try to think about what you had before your workout and make adjustments. If it happens ALL the time, your diet may be too high protein, and too little carb in general: you need more carbs to support the level of training you’re doing, or on days you workout. Sweet potatoes, fruit, yogurt etc.
Workouts over 60 minutes should have a wee re-fuel break: I HATE to say ‘sports’ drink, but I’ll list it as an option (read the labels for chemical yuckness). Smoothies, juices, quick nibbles are also good if you plan on hitting it longer than an hour, and are usually easy on the way ‘down’. Around 60 minutes, the body starts to release hormones to store fat, and if you’ve run out of ‘juice’, it’ll turn to your muscles for energy. Yup. It eats them up.
While low carb diets work for weight loss, if you’re training INTENSELY, you need to make sure you’re eating enough to support it. The body runs on glucose & fat for workout energy, but when it runs out all it has is precious muscle to feed it. No good, right? :)
